Charter of Demands vs. Notice of Change
Charter of Demands refers to demands put forward by the Trade Union before the Management. On the other hand, a Notice of Change is the notice issued to employees under Section 9A of the ID Act, stating that the mentioned changes will be effected on the service conditions of the workmen with effect from the date mentioned therein.
